Hard to say since I don’t know what you usually eat, but I was wondering if you use coupons? I get the Sunday paper which is $1.50 and the paper has tons of coupons that could save you several dollars a week. You would save on food items, paper items including toilet paper, dish washing soap, laundry detergent, etc.
